Samsung Galaxy A15 5G: The Display Champion

The Samsung Galaxy A15 5G stands out as the premier budget choice, offering a stunning 6.5-inch AMOLED display with 90Hz refresh rate that rivals phones costing twice as much. Powered by the MediaTek 6835 chipset and 4GB of RAM, this device handles everyday tasks with impressive efficiency. Samsung’s commitment to software support shines here, providing four years of major Android updates and security patches through 2029. At just $200, the A15 5G delivers exceptional value with its vibrant display, solid performance, and long-lasting battery life.

Nothing Phone 3a: The Design Innovator

The Nothing Phone 3a brings a unique flair to the budget segment with its signature glyph interface and premium build quality. Featuring a large 6.77-inch AMOLED display capable of 3000 nits brightness and 120Hz refresh rate, this device offers flagship-level visual experiences. The Snapdragon 7s Gen 3 processor ensures smooth performance, while the 5,000mAh battery with 50W fast charging keeps you powered throughout the day. What sets it apart is the inclusion of a telephoto camera, a rarity in budget smartphones.

Google Pixel 8a: The Photography Expert

Google’s Pixel 8a continues the tradition of exceptional computational photography in an affordable package. The device leverages Google’s advanced AI processing to deliver stunning photos that often surpass more expensive competitors. With guaranteed software updates directly from Google and integration with the latest Android features, the Pixel 8a represents excellent long-term value for photography enthusiasts.

Motorola Moto G Power 5G: The Battery Champion

The Motorola Moto G Power 5G focuses on endurance and reliability, featuring the MediaTek Dimensity 930 processor and ultra-fast 5G capabilities. Its 6.5-inch Full HD+ display with 120Hz refresh rate provides smooth scrolling and responsive gaming experiences. Motorola’s near-stock Android experience ensures clean software without unnecessary bloatware, making it ideal for users who prefer simplicity.

Key Features to Consider in Budget Smartphones

Display Technology and Performance

Modern budget smartphones have embraced AMOLED technology, delivering vibrant colors, deep blacks, and excellent outdoor visibility. High refresh rates of 90Hz or 120Hz have become standard, ensuring smooth scrolling and responsive touch interactions that were once exclusive to premium devices.

Camera Capabilities

Today’s budget phones feature sophisticated camera systems with multiple lenses, AI-enhanced photography, and impressive low-light performance. Computational photography has leveled the playing field, allowing budget devices to capture stunning images through software optimization.

Software Support and Longevity

Extended software support has become a crucial differentiator, with manufacturers now offering multiple years of Android updates and security patches. This ensures your budget smartphone remains current and secure throughout its lifespan.

5G Connectivity and Future-Proofing

5G support is now standard across most budget smartphones, ensuring compatibility with current and future network technologies. This future-proofing aspect makes budget phones viable long-term investments.
